#428592 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#428592 is composed of 25.9% red, 52.2% green and 57.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.8% cyan, 8.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 42.7% black. It has a hue angle of 189.8 degrees, a saturation of 37.7% and a lightness of 41.6%. #428592 color hex could be obtained by blending #84ffff with #000b25.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

#428592 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#428592 has RGB values of R:66, G:133, B:146 and CMYK values of C:0.55, M:0.09, Y:0,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 4359570.
